Elaborate security arrangement for Puri Rath Yatra

Last Updated June 06, 2019

Puri: Director General of Police (DGP) Dr Rajendra Prasad Sharma today said that at least 155 platoons of police forces will be pressed into service along with three units of Anti-Terrorist Squads (ATS), two companies of Rapid Action Force (RPF), and three companies of Swift Action Force (SAF) for the ensuing annual Rath Yatra in Puri. This year Rath Yatra falls on July 4. Security arrangements will be in place till Niladri Bije on July 15. Sharma, who chaired a review meeting on security arrangements, said the CCTV cameras that were damaged due to the cyclone Fani, will be repaired or replaced to keep a watch on anti-social activities during the fete. The DGP also allotted exclusive responsibility to senior IPS officers to make the annual car festival incident-free. Railways and Coastal ADG Pranabindu Acharya will supervise the arrangements of railways police while IG (Intelligence) RK Sharma will supervise security and special branch arrangements and IG (Headquarters) Asit Panigarhi will monitor crowd control management and IG (Crime Branch CID) will monitor crowd near the cordons of the three chariots. While ADG (Law and order) Sanjeeb Panda will to take charge of law and order IG (SAP) Amitabh Thakur will look after the traffic management. IG (Central Range) Soumendra Priyadarshi will be the security in-charge of inside the 12th century shrine premises during the festival.
